Naomi Watts on her Princess Di role

naomi_watts

Australian actress Naomi Watts, who is playing Britain’s Princess Diana in a new film, says she was so focussed on the interview the late princess did with Martin Bashir that she watched it as she worked out.

The biopic film entitled “Diana” will be released soon and Watts said she used the interview with Bashir on the BBC’s Panorama programme to help her fine-tune the Princess of Wales’ mannerisms.

The interview was first aired in 1995 and created much controversy at the time. During the now infamous interview Diana stated: “There were three people in this marriage” referring to Prince Charles’ relationship with now wife Camilla Parker Bowles.

Said Watts to Hello! Magazine: “I ran the Martin Bashir TV interview so often that it got to the point where I was watching it on my iPhone while I was out jogging. ”I had five minutes of her walk, five minutes of her wave, five minutes of her laugh that I’d watch again and again.”

The film will depict the final two years in the princess’s life just after her divorce from Prince Charles and just before she died in a car crash in Paris in August 1997. Watts recently walked out of an interview on BBC radio after becoming uncomfortable with the questions she was being asked about Diana.

Moderat ready to release second album

moderat

The Berlin techno super group Moderat is preparing to release its second album entitled II later  this year. The group, made up of Modeselektor with Sebastian Szary and Gernot Bronsert and Apparat (Sascha Ring). The trio has been working together for the last ten years after coming together to find ways to explore electronic music after meeting at a festival in Berlin.

One of the highlights of the new album, which was written in the dead of winter, is that all the beats were done from scratch using both sampled and re-sampled music from the studio – analog and looped.

The new album features synths, warm bass tones and rolling drum programming, as well as melancholy vocals. The group says it continues working together because of a shared past in the German city attending illegal parties following reunification.

In an interview with Electronic Beats, Moderat said that all the members worked on getting the album together. “Everybody did everything, it wasn’t like one person was the drum programmer and the other one was making the melodies. It’s really mixed,” said Sascha Ring. “We wanted to resample stuff and use it over and over again. We wanted to wear the sound out on purpose,” Ring added.

Eggs Florentine, breakfast with “glam”

eggs_florentine

For a breakfast with a little more glam and prep time try Eggs Florentine. Eggs Florentine is poached eggs served on toasted sourdough bread with spinach and Hollandaise sauce.

To prepare you will need 4 eggs, 1 bunch of baby spinach, 3 tsp of white vinegar, 2 thick slices of sourdough bread, butter, Hollandaise dressing, 5 black peppercorns, 1 bay leaf, 2 egg yolks,2 tsp lemon juice, 1/2 tsp of salt.

Make the Hollandaise sauce by combining the vinegar, peppercorns, and bay leaf in a saucepan over low flame. Allow to simmer until the mixture reduces to 2 teaspoons. Remove from heat,strain, and set aside.Use a heatproof bowl over a medium saucepan with water. Remove the bowl from the saucepan and bring the water to the boil.

As the water boils use egg yolks and vinegar and whisk until combined. When the water has boiled place the egg mixture over the saucepan and use a whisk to mix for 3 minutes until thick and has doubled in volume. Whisk the mixture and warm melted butter a few drops at a timeuntil incorporated. Mix lemon juice and add salt and pepper.

To prepare the eggs put vinegar in a frying pan with water and boil over a low flame. Break 1 egg into a saucer and use a large spoon to make a small eddy in the water. Then add egg in the middle and poach for 1 or 2 minutes. When cooked transfer to a plate. Cook spinach in water and drain. Toast bread and put on a plate. Add spinach, poached eggs and drizzle with hollandaise sauce.

Florence, history’s new birthplace

Florence_italy

Florence is a city in Italy’s Tuscany region famous for being the fashion capital of the country as well as the heart of the Renaissance. The city is famous for its history and architecture and is a Unesco World Heritage Site.

Among the most famous museums in Florence are the Uffizi Gallery and the Pitti Palace. Other sites which may interest tourists are the famous Santa Maria Fiore cathedral, the Campanilewhich sits nearby, and the Baptistery and the Palazzo Vecchio and Ponte Vecchio. ThePiazza della Signoria is in the city’s centre.

The city is on a basin near the Senese Clavey Hills and the Arno River. The city has a humid sub-tropical and Mediterranean climate and has hot humid summers and cool damps winters.

Food is very important in Italian culture and also in Florence as well as wine. The city sits in Italy’s Tuscany region famous for its wines. Not far from Florence is the Chianti region.

The Osteria Vini e Vecchi Sapari is the most highly recommended restaurant in the city where reservations are mandatory. Food includes tripe and lampdredotto, antipasti, and salt less Tuscan bread. The city is served by the Amerigo Vespucci Airport and also has a city bus and tram and railway stations.

Dame Judi Stars in lost and found

philomena
British actress Dame Judi Dench is to star as a woman searching for her long lost son in the film “Philomena”. In the movie, Dench, who has also had starring roles in such films as “Mrs. Brown” in which she played Queen Victoria and as the title character’s boss M in the James Bond films, plays a woman who was forced to give up her son for adoption by the Catholic Church.

Her search begins 50 years later. The film also stars British actor Steve Coogan who has had a recent successful turn in the film “Alpha Papa”. Coogan plays political journalist Martin Sixsmith who intended to write the story of the search but ended up helping Philomena instead.

The film is directed Stephen Frears who also directed such flicks as “My Beautiful Laundrette” and “The Queen”. “Philomena” will be released in British cinemas on November 1. Dench has won a Best Supporting Actress Academy Awards for her role in “Shakespeare in Love” as well as a Tony for Best Actress in a Play for “Amy’s View”.

She has also won a slew of BAFTA Awards as well as Golden Globe and Screen Actors Guild Awards. Her most recent role was in 2012’s “Skyfall”.

How Theo Hutchcraft adores Jeremy Irons

theo_hutchcraft
Hurts band member Theo Hutchcraft is a big fan of British star Jeremy Irons. According to Hutchcraft, who was doing a piece for Electronic Beats website, he was once told that the films a person likes and the star a child idolises are the people and things you emulate as an adult. For Hutchcraft, that person is Irons who for him is the consumate actor.

“I found this really great, stark black and white picture of him the other day wearing a monocle and a polo neck by the photographer Michel Comte in an Interview Magazine from 1990“, says Hutchcraft.

“There’s another photograph that I really like where he’s wearing a suit matched with a pair of Nike trainers. It’s something about his demeanor that suggests a romantic back story that I want to rifle through“.

Irons has of course won Academy Awards for his role in such films as “Reversal of Fortune“. He has also played in “The Man in the Iron Mask“.

Said Hutchcraft: “He’s this established Hollywood star so he probably has a beautiful house and a nice car; but it’s about more than the usual trappings.

He looks like he could live in some sort of house in Paris or somewhere in rural France with a vineyard. Or else he looks like you might see him on a yacht or a small canal boat tending to the flowers on the roof”.

And Hutchcraft thinks that while Hurts isn’t a lot like Irons they have managed to fool people into thinking that. “If I’m like Jeremy Irons when I’m old, I’ll be a very, very happy man”.

Macaroni and Cheese pie

macaroni_and_cheese
The macaroni and cheese is one of the simplest meals available and with the right spices can be extra tasty. To make you need cooking spray, 2 cups uncooked elbow macaroni, 1/2 cup butter, 2 cans evaporated milk, 1 tablespoon black pepper, 3 eggs, salt, 4 cups shredded Cheddar cheese, and paprika.

To prepare, preheat the oven to 425 degrees F and spray a small casserole dish with cooking spray. In a saucepan add water and salt and bring to a boil before adding macaroni. Add oil to prevent macaroni pieces sticking together. Once cooked, remove macaroni and drain.

Melt butter in a pot over a low flame and add evaporated milk and pepper until warm. Beat eggs in a bowl and add evaporated milk mixture whisking until smooth.

Continue to warm over the low flame until thick and add macaroni and stir. Put macaroni mixture in a dish. Add shredded cheese and top with more macaroni. Do this until macaroni is finished, then top with cheese. Bake for about 20 minutes in a casserole.

To add extra flavour to a macaroni and cheese you may also add finely chopped onions and chopped bell peppers. In some recipes the onions and peppers may be blended with the milk and egg mixture for added taste.

Miami beach, incredible destination

miami

Miami is a city located on the southeastern coast of Florida and is ranked as the richest city in the USA. It is the top cruise passenger port in the world and the busiest port for tourists.

The area is good for shopping as well as a few tourist sites with the nearbyFlorida Everglades and the Downtown Miami Historic District which dates back to 1896 and nearby South Beach and Miami Beach.

Miami is an eclectic mix of Latin American and Caribbean cultures with a huge population of Cubans and Dominicans and is known as the Capital of Latin America.

The city has a tropical monsoon climate with hot humid summers and warm winters. Visitors can experience a number of cultural showcases including annual festivals such as the Calle Ocho Festival and Carnaval Miami.

Among the performing centres are the Ziff Ballet Opera House and theCarnival Studio Theater. There exist many museums including the Frost Art MuseumHistory MiamiMiami Art Museum, and the Miami Children’s Museum.

For those who wish a quieter visit, there are many parks includingBayfront Park and Bicentennial Park. Other destinations include the Jungle IslandZoo Island, and Zoo Miami as well as the Miami Seaquarium.

Food is heavily influenced by Latin folk with the Cuban sandwich and medianoche as well as Cuban espresso being quite popular. One can visit the Versailles Restaurant in Little Havanaand other more popular brands exist such as Tony Roma’s.

British star Naomie Harris to play Winnie Mandela

naomie_harris
British actress Naomie Harris is to play Winnie Mandela the former wife of former South African president Nelson Mandela in an upcoming film and according to Harris has gotten the blessing of Mandela.

Harris has had smaller roles in movies but got a key role as Miss Moneypenny in last year’s James Bond film “Skyfall”.

The actress, who is of Jamaican parentage, but has lived in England, said she visited Mandela who was Nelson’s second wife and revealed that the black heroine who remained married to Mandela while her was in prison on Robben’s Island for 27 years was ok with her role in the upcoming flick “Mandela: Long Walk to Freedom”.

According to Harris the meeting was a fantastic experience in which she asked Mandela who she wished to be presented and what was the take away she wanted people to have from the movie.

Harris told Empire magazine that Mandela’s response was “’I just want the story to be told truthfully. You’ve done your research, you’ve read enough about me just make it your own.”

British actor, Idris Elba, will play Nelson Mandela in the movie which is set to be released in cinemas January 2014.

Zagreb Festival coming up

zagreb_festival

The Electronic Beats Fall Festival continues with some magnificent stops this year in places such as BudapestHungaryDresdenGermanyVienna,Austria, and PodgoricaMontenegro.

The festival stops in the Croatian capital city of Zagreb on November 8 with four of the biggest names in electro beat music. The festival will be staged atBoogaloo in Zagreb. The Danish group Efterklang, who released the LP Piramada last year, will headline the night’s events with their orchestral pop music.

Also on the line up will be German Deep House DJ and Producer Fritz Kalkbrenner from out of Berlin. Fritz is brother to Paul and he will bring with him a blend of soul, hip-hop, and techno music.

The brothers worked on the music for the film “Berlin Calling” back in 2008. His last single releases were Little by Little and Get A Life from 2012.

The up-and-coming Dena also performs and comes highly recommended with an older groove with a mix of 90’s beat R&B and a more modern groove.

The final act planned for the evening is MS MR from New York City. Electronic Beats stages a series of live concerts, club nights, and festivals across Europe.
